classPrefRoute
Module: CLEARTRAC7-MIB
OID (symbolic): CLEARTRAC7-MIB::classPrefRoute
O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.727.7.2.9.3.1.3
Node type: OBJECT-TYPE
Type: DisplayString
Access: read-write
Description: Identifies the name of the cleartrac unit to be used as the next hop for sending transparent or PVC multiplex data over multiple direct links (point-to-point or rack backbone connections), where more than one route is available and all available routes are equal in cost. Assigning a different preferred route to different classes ensures static load balancing of transparent traffic over all routes.
What is classPrefRoute?
This read-write string names the cleartrac unit to use as the next hop for a class's transparent or PVC multiplex traffic when several equal-cost direct links or rack backbone connections are available. It matters operationally because assigning different preferred routes to different classes lets an admin statically load-balance traffic across redundant physical paths instead of letting the system pick arbitrarily. For example, an admin could point a low-priority class's classPrefRoute at 'RACK2-UNIT' so its traffic takes a separate backbone path from the mission-critical class.
Examples
Walk all instances (SNMPv2c):
sn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.727.7.2.9.3.1.3 sn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> CLEARTRAC7-MIB::classPrefRoute
Get a specific instance (index 1):
snmpget -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.727.7.2.9.3.1.3.1 snmpget -v2c -c public <target> CLEARTRAC7-MIB::classPrefRoute.1
Set instance 1 (SNMPv2c):
snmpset -v2c -c private <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.727.7.2.9.3.1.3.1 s <value>
SNMPv3 example:
snmpget -v3 -l authPriv -u snmpv3-user -a SHA -A "AuthPassword1" -x AES -X "PrivPassword1" <target> classPrefRoute.1
